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Marsden (Yorks) to Inverness start from as little as £26.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Marsden (Yorks) to Inverness start from £97.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Marsden (Yorks) to Inverness are available for £111.20 one way

Station Facilities and Services

Though Marsden (Yorks) station may not boast a ticket office, it offers modern conveniences for ticket collection and purchase. Ticket machines are readily available to assist passengers with their travel arrangements. Furthermore, the station embraces accessibility, providing induction loops and accessible ticket machines to ensure everyone can manage their travel needs seamlessly.

Despite the absence of station staff, help is never far away. Passengers can rely on customer help points as well as a dedicated helpline to address any concerns they might have. It's important to note, however, that the station does not have CCTV, waiting rooms, or refreshment facilities, so it may be worth planning ahead if you're in need of such amenities during your stop.

Transportation Connectivity

For those looking to continue their journey from Marsden, the station is well-integrated with alternative transport options. A rail replacement service is conveniently located by the station car park, ensuring smooth transitions even when train services are disrupted. Marsden is well-connected with local bus services, with Busline available at 0871 200 2233 for up-to-date travel information. For taxi services, you can book with ease through Cab4You, enhancing your onward travel options.

Station Facilities

Inverness Station is well-equipped to ensure that your travel begins on a pleasant note. Its ticket office operates with ample hours, from Monday to Friday, from 06:30 to 20:30, and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. Savvy travelers can swiftly collect pre-purchased tickets via the on-site ticket machines, meticulously designed with accessibility in focus.

Adding to the ease of travel, customer support is available through help points and ticket offices, with ample staff presence to assist daily. While luggage storage is unfortunately unavailable, CCTV facilities offer added security. Travelers with accessibility needs will find comfort in the step-free access available throughout the station, with accessible toilets and a staff-help service running from early morning until just past midnight.

Get Connected with Onward Transport Options

Navigating from Inverness station is a breeze with multiple transportation options at your disposal. Rail replacement services are accessible from the Eastgate side, while local bus services and taxis further enhance connectivity. Be it exploring the city or heading to Inverness Airport, a variety of local bus services extends from the station.

Inverness Bike Hire makes your transit exciting for those favoring an eco-friendly route, offering discounted cycle hire to rail ticket holders right from the station grounds.
